Output e7fada598602bc822d7e2502c53051043e9d49373e6dd3b71d7e76e5770c76bd:0

value
2662939
script pubkey
OP_0 OP_PUSHBYTES_20 e1da1db09e01b5c3eb0e09ece5a8a2eace52a8bc
address
bc1qu8dpmvy7qx6u86cwp8kwt29zat89929uhq2f7r
transaction
e7fada598602bc822d7e2502c53051043e9d49373e6dd3b71d7e76e5770c76bd
spent
true